Namespace Declaration Hiding

Question: does oXygen XML currently provide any features for hiding of namespace declaration attributes (I haven't upgraded to V7 yet so I can't check there)? If it doesn't, is it on the feature request list? What I'm thinking of is an option that would hide or iconize in some way namespace declaration attributes on start tags within the text editor. There would have to be an easy way to examine a tag to see what namespaces either it declares or are mapped in its scope. This would make it much easier to author documents where you have a mix of elements from different namespaces and you want to declare these namespaces as defaults. This is especially problematic in, for example, technical documentation where you might have a number of different vocabularies used for inline markup within paragraphs, where having lots of namespace declaration attributes would definitely be disruptive and annoying.
